Practical Applications: Efficiency at Scale
One of the key aspects of this course is its emphasis on practical applications. Participants learn how to apply theoretical knowledge to real-world problems. Here are a few examples of the practical applications covered in the program:
1. Water Demand Forecasting: Accurate forecasting of water demand is crucial for effective resource management. The course teaches participants how to use historical data and predictive models to forecast future water demands accurately. This is particularly useful in regions experiencing rapid urbanization and population growth.
2. Hydrological Modeling: Hydrological models are essential for understanding water flow and distribution. The course provides hands-on training on using advanced software tools like Hydrological Modelling System (HMS) and Hydrological Simulation Program-Fortran (HSPF). These tools help in simulating different scenarios and making informed decisions about water allocation.
3. Optimization Techniques: Optimization techniques are used to allocate water resources in a way that maximizes efficiency and minimizes waste. Participants learn about linear programming, dynamic programming, and other advanced optimization methods. These techniques are applied in various scenarios, such as agricultural irrigation, municipal water supply, and industrial water use.
Real-World Case Studies: Making a Difference
To bring the theoretical knowledge to life, the course includes numerous case studies from around the world. These case studies showcase the practical applications of the concepts learned and demonstrate the impact of effective water resource management.
1. The Murray-Darling Basin, Australia: The Murray-Darling Basin is one of the most significant agricultural regions in Australia. The course explores how a comprehensive water management plan was implemented to restore the health of the river system. This includes the allocation of water for environmental flows, agricultural use, and urban consumption, ensuring a sustainable balance.
2. The Aral Sea Crisis, Central Asia: The Aral Sea crisis is a stark example of the consequences of poor water management. The course examines how the over-extraction of water for irrigation purposes led to the near-dryness of the Aral Sea. Participants learn about the steps taken to reverse this trend, including the allocation of water for ecological restoration and sustainable agriculture.
3. The Colorado River Basin, USA: The Colorado River Basin is a critical water resource for the western United States. The course looks at the complex water management challenges faced in this region, including droughts, over-extraction, and competing demands from various stakeholders. Participants learn about the innovative solutions implemented to ensure a sustainable water future.
